• 제목/요약/키워드: Virtual camera

검색결과 479건 처리시간 0.023초

Kinect 깊이 카메라를 이용한 가상시점 영상생성 기술 (Intermediate View Synthesis Method using Kinect Depth Camera)

  • 이상범;호요성
    • 스마트미디어저널
    • /
    • 제1권3호
    • /
    • pp.29-35
    • /
    • 2012
  • 깊이영상기반 렌더링(depth image-based rendering, DIBR)이란 색상 영상과 각 화소에 대응하는 거리 정보로 이루어진 깊이 영상(depth map)을 이용하여 가상 시점에서의 영상을 합성하는 기술을 말한다. DIBR을 이용하면 3차원 TV에 적합한 컨텐츠를 생성할 수 있지만, 가상 시점에서의 영상을 합성하는 과정에서 원영상에 존재하지 않는 영역, 즉, 비폐색(disocclusion) 영역이 드러나는 등 여러 가지 문제가 발생한다. 본 논문에서는 구조광으로 깊이 정보를 획득하는 Kinect 깊이 카메라를 이용한 가상시점 영상생성 기술을 제안한다. 깊이 카메라로부터 색상 영상과 그에 대응하는 깊이 영상을 획득한 다음, 깊이 영상에 대한 전처리 기술을 수행한다. 전처리가 끝난 깊이 영상은 중간 시점으로 워핑되고, 워핑 과정에서 발생하는 절삭 오차를 제거하기 위해 Median 필터링을 적용한다. 그런 다음, 색상 영상은 워핑된 깊이 영상의 깊이 값을 사용해서 중간 시점으로 워핑된다. 비폐색(disocclusion) 영역을 채우기 위해 배경 기반의 인페인팅 기술을 적용한다. 실험 결과를 통해, 본 논문에서 제안한 방법이 자연스러운 스테레오 영상을 생성한 것을 확인할 수 있었다.

  • PDF

다중 동적객체의 실시간 독립추적을 통한 프로젝션 증강가시화 (Real-Time Individual Tracking of Multiple Moving Objects for Projection based Augmented Visualization)

  • 이준형;김기홍
    • 디지털융복합연구
    • /
    • 제12권11호
    • /
    • pp.357-364
    • /
    • 2014
  • 기존 증강현실 콘텐츠 경우 고정된 마커를 빠르게 이동시키면 가시화에 끊김 현상이 발생하게 된다. 따라서 동적 마커를 사용할 경우에도 콘텐츠가 끊어짐 없이 사용자에게 제공되는 방법이 요구된다. 카메라에 입력된 한 장의 이미지 내에 두 개 이상의 마커가 존재할 경우 기존의 이미지 기반 마커와 SLAM(Simultaneous Localization & Mapping) 방식을 통해서는 각각의 마커를 동시에 추적할 수 없다. 본 논문은 각 마커 위에 정합된 객체들 간의 상호작용은 불가능하다는 점을 극복함은 물론, 빠르게 움직이는 마커를 실시간으로 추적하여 그 위에 원하는 객체를 정확하게 증강 가시화하는 방법론을 제안한다. 이를 위해, 주행형 로봇과 시범 콘텐츠의 가상로봇을 동기화하여, 주행형 로봇 상에 콘텐츠가 가시화되도록 하였다. 그리고 카메라 한 대로 다중 동적객체를 추적하여 서로 상호작용하는 기술을 제안하였다. 결과적으로 가상로봇과 실제로봇을 연동하여 상호작용하도록 함으로써 실시간 동적객체 추적 및 가시화 기술의 유용성을 검증하였다.

머리의 자세를 추적하기 위한 효율적인 카메라 보정 방법에 관한 연구 (An Efficient Camera Calibration Method for Head Pose Tracking)

  • 박경수;임창주;이경태
    • 대한인간공학회지
    • /
    • 제19권1호
    • /
    • pp.77-90
    • /
    • 2000
  • The aim of this study is to develop and evaluate an efficient camera calibration method for vision-based head tracking. Tracking head movements is important in the design of an eye-controlled human/computer interface. A vision-based head tracking system was proposed to allow the user's head movements in the design of the eye-controlled human/computer interface. We proposed an efficient camera calibration method to track the 3D position and orientation of the user's head accurately. We also evaluated the performance of the proposed method. The experimental error analysis results showed that the proposed method can provide more accurate and stable pose (i.e. position and orientation) of the camera than the conventional direct linear transformation method which has been used in camera calibration. The results of this study can be applied to the tracking head movements related to the eye-controlled human/computer interface and the virtual reality technology.

  • PDF

멀티뷰 카메라를 사용한 외부 카메라 보정 (Extrinsic calibration using a multi-view camera)

  • 김기영;김세환;박종일;우운택
    • 대한전자공학회:학술대회논문집
    • /
    • 대한전자공학회 2003년도 신호처리소사이어티 추계학술대회 논문집
    • /
    • pp.187-190
    • /
    • 2003
  • In this paper, we propose an extrinsic calibration method for a multi-view camera to get an optimal pose in 3D space. Conventional calibration algorithms do not guarantee the calibration accuracy at a mid/long distance because pixel errors increase as the distance between camera and pattern goes far. To compensate for the calibration errors, firstly, we apply the Tsai's algorithm to each lens so that we obtain initial extrinsic parameters Then, we estimate extrinsic parameters by using distance vectors obtained from structural cues of a multi-view camera. After we get the estimated extrinsic parameters of each lens, we carry out a non-linear optimization using the relationship between camera coordinate and world coordinate iteratively. The optimal camera parameters can be used in generating 3D panoramic virtual environment and supporting AR applications.

  • PDF

비디오 영상에서의 비보정 3차원 좌표 복원을 통한 가상 객체의 비디오 합성 (Video Augmentation of Virtual Object by Uncalibrated 3D Reconstruction from Video Frames)

  • 박종승;성미영
    • 한국멀티미디어학회논문지
    • /
    • 제9권4호
    • /
    • pp.421-433
    • /
    • 2006
  • 본 논문에서는 비디오에서 비보정 3차원 좌표의 복원과 카메라의 움직임 추정을 통하여 가상 객체를 비디오에 자연스럽게 합성하는 방법을 제안한다. 비디오의 장면에 부합되도록 가상 객체를 삽입하기 위해서는 장면의 상대적인 구조를 얻어야 하고 비디오 프레임의 흐름에 따른 카메라 움직임의 변화도 추정해야 한다. 먼저 특장점을 추적하고 비보정 절차를 수행하여 카메라 파라메터와 3차원 구조를 복원한다. 각 프레임에서 카메라 파라메터들을 고정시켜 촬영하고 이들 카메라 파라메터는 일정 프레임 동안 불변으로 가정하였다. 제안된 방법으로 세 프레임 이상에서 작은 수의 특징점 만으로도 올바른 3차원 구조를 얻을 수 있었다. 가상객체의 삽입 위치는 초기 프레임에서 특정 면의 모서리점의 대응점을 지정하여 결정한다. 가상 객체의 투사 영역을 계산하고 이 영역에 이음새가 없도록 텍스처를 혼합하여 가상객체와 비디오의 부자연스러운 합성 문제를 해결하였다. 제안 방법은 비보정 절차를 선형으로만 구현하여 기존의 방법에 비해서 안정성과 수행속도의 면에서 우수하다. 실제 비디오 스트림에 대한 다양한 실험을 수행한 결과 여러 증강현실 응용 시스템에 유용하게 사용될 수 있음을 입증하였다.

  • PDF

디지털영상 합성을 위한 가상카메라의 트래킹 데이터 보정에 관한 연구 (A Study on Correcting Virtual Camera Tracking Data for Digital Compositing)

  • 이준상;이임건
    • 한국컴퓨터정보학회논문지
    • /
    • 제17권11호
    • /
    • pp.39-46
    • /
    • 2012
  • 디지털 시대에서 컴퓨터 기술의 발전은 각종 사물의 표현력을 강화시키고 있다. 영상에 있어서 컴퓨터그래픽의 발전은 인간이 상상하고 있는 이미지를 현실세계에서 구현 불가능한 것을 효과적으로 나타내고 있다. 영화 등 컴퓨터 그래픽 기술은 영상제작에 있어 전체 흐름의 중심을 차지하는 핵심적인 요소로 발전하고 있으나 국내의 경우, 영상 콘텐츠의 제작 과정에서 연구 개발을 병행하기 어려운 열악한 상황이고 해외 상용 툴에 대한 의존도가 높은 것이 사실이다. 영상합성의 제작에서 실사장면을 촬영하고 실사영상을 컴퓨터 그래픽 이미지에 매치무빙 하는 과정은 매우 복잡한 과정을 거치게 된다. 이 때 중요하게 고려되어야 할 사항이 카메라 트래킹이다. 카메라 트래킹은 촬영된 실사영상만으로 실사카메라의 3차원 이동정보와 광학적 파라미터 등 촬영시의 3차원 공간을 복원하는 과정을 포함하고 있다. 이 과정에서 카메라 트래킹에 대한 오류로 인해 실사와 CG의 합성에 대한 생산성에 많은 문제점을 발생시킨다. 본 논문에서는 이러한 문제를 해결하기 위하여 소프트웨어에서 트래킹데이터를 보정하는 방법을 제안한다.

가상 환경에서의 영상 기반 시각 서보잉을 통한 로봇 OLP 보상 (A Study on Robot OLP Compensation Based on Image Based Visual Servoing in the Virtual Environment)

  • 신찬배;이재원;김진대
    • 제어로봇시스템학회논문지
    • /
    • 제12권3호
    • /
    • pp.248-254
    • /
    • 2006
  • It is necessary to improve the exactness and adaptation of the working environment for the intelligent robot system. The vision sensor have been studied for a long time at this points. However, it has many processes and difficulties for the real usages. This paper proposes a visual servoing in the virtual environment to support OLP(Off-Line-Programming) path compensation and supplement the problem of complexity of the old kinematical calibration. Initial robot path could be compensated by pixel differences between real and virtual image. This method removes the varies calibrations and 3D reconstruction process in real working space. To show the validity of the proposed approach, virtual space servoing with stereo camera is carried out with WTK and openGL library for a KUKA-6R manipulator and updated real robot path.

근접한 물체 사이의 공간 관찰을 위한 보조 카메라 위치 최적화 (Secondary camera position optimization for observing the close space between objects)

  • 이지혜;한윤하;최명걸
    • 한국컴퓨터그래픽스학회논문지
    • /
    • 제24권3호
    • /
    • pp.33-41
    • /
    • 2018
  • 본 논문에서는 3차원 가상 공간을 탐험하는 사용자가 가상 물체들 사이의 충돌 위험 영역을 정밀하게 관찰할 수 있도록 돕는 보조 카메라 최적화 기술을 소개한다. 보조 카메라의 역할은 두 물체 사이의 충돌 위험 영역을 자동으로 감지하고 해당 영역을 현재 메인 카메라가 보여줄 수 없는 새로운 시점에서 관찰하여 사용자에게 보여주는 것이다. 하지만 가상 물체의 기하학적 모양이 복잡한 경우 충돌 위험 주변 공간도 좁고 복잡해진다. 그 결과, 보조 카메라의 위치 설정에 많은 제약이 따르고 최적화 계산의 복잡도 역시 높아진다. 본 논문에서는 보조 카메라의 위치를 두 물체 사이에 계산된 바이섹터-서피스 상의 점으로 제한함으로써 공간적 제약 조건을 지킴과 동시에 최적화의 효율성을 높이는 방법을 제시한다. 검증을 위해 사용자가 핸드 모션 인식 장치를 이용해 3차원 가상 환경을 탐험하게 하는 프로그램을 제작하였으며 사용자 조사를 통해 효용성을 확인하였다.

Internet-based Teleoperation of a Mobile Robot with Force-reflection

  • Lim, Jae-Nam;Moon, Hae-Gon;Ko, Jae-Pyung;Lee, Jang-Myung
    • 제어로봇시스템학회:학술대회논문집
    • /
    • 제어로봇시스템학회 2002년도 ICCAS
    • /
    • pp.50.6-50
    • /
    • 2002
  • In this paper, the relationship between a slave robot and the uncertain remote environment is modeled as the impedance to generate the virtual force to feed back to the operator. For the control of a teleoperated mobile robot equipped with camera, the teleoperated mobile robot take pictures of remote environment and sends the visual information back to the operator over the Internet. Because of the limitation of communication bandwidth and narrow view-angles of camera, it is not possible to watch the environment clearly, especially shadow and curved areas. To overcome this problem, the virtual force is generated according to both the distance between the obstacle and robot and the approachin...

  • PDF

다중 블럽 마커를 이용한 스테레오 비전 혼합현실 시스템의 구현 (Stereo vision mixed reality system using the multi-blob marker)

  • 양기선;김한성;손광훈
    • 대한전자공학회:학술대회논문집
    • /
    • 대한전자공학회 2003년도 하계종합학술대회 논문집 Ⅳ
    • /
    • pp.1907-1910
    • /
    • 2003
  • This paper describes a method of stereo image composition for mixed reality without camera calibration or complicate tracking algorithm. The proposed system tracks the panel which has blob makers, and composes virtual objects naturally using the method of texture mapping which is often used in geological computer graphics mapping when we do mapping 2D computer graphic data or man-made 2D images. The proposed algorithm makes it possible for us to compose virtual data even in the case that the panel is bent. For composing 3D object, the system uses depth information obtained from stereo image so that we do not need cumbersome procedure of camera calibration.

  • PDF